  • M&S clothing slips into third place

    October 8, 2009

    Marks & Spencer has fallen into third place among Britain’s fashion retailers in terms of volume of clothes sold, trailing behind George at Asda and Primark, according toTNSFashion Trak. M&S fashion sales have suffered as consumers switched to cheaper rivals during the recession.

  • Primark to beat retail gloom

    September 21, 2009

    Primark is set to become a major European force as retailers offering low-cost goods thrive in the recession, according to research out today by Verdict analysts. Verdict predicts the European retail sector will shrink by 5.2 per cent to in 2009, but that value retailers will outperform the market.
